About the Role
Ecolab, a global leader in cleaning, sanitizing, and maintenance products and services, is seeking a Sr Production Specialist for its facility in Dammam, Eastern Province, Saudi Arabia. This role is responsible for managing and leading a production shift, overseeing all aspects of plant operations including preparation (mixing), filling, packaging, and tote washing. The position offers an opportunity to contribute to solving significant global challenges related to clean water, safe food, abundant energy, and healthy environments. Ecolab is committed to providing a long-term career path and fostering a culture that values sustainability, safety, and ethical conduct.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age and lead the production shift, ensuring adherence to the production plan in a safe and efficient manner.
- Oversee and perform operations on the production lines, including loading empty containers, labeling, preparation (mixing), filling, capping, bar code generation, and taking samples.
- Ensure the correct raw and packaging materials are available for production runs.
- Review preparation (mixing), filling, and packaging instructions at the beginning of line runs.
- Enter production data accurately into the warehouse management system.
- Report damages and discrepancies for accounting and record-keeping purposes.
- Recommend, implement, and promote measures to improve departmental productivity and efficiencies, product quality, methods, and working conditions to minimize downtime.
- Follow Total Production Management (TPM) and continuous improvement principles.
- Proactively communicate maintenance needs, quality issues, or other situations impacting safety, quality, or productivity to the appropriate functional or department leader.
- Assist in training teammates.
- Maintain a clean and safe work environment, ensuring good housekeeping practices throughout the plant.
- Complete cycle counts regularly and manage inventory for the Production department.
- Keep equipment in good condition through cleaning, testing, and inspection.
- Follow and adhere to operational and safety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and good practices in daily operations.
- Execute SAP tasks, including opening/closing process orders and printing labels correctly and timely.
- Ensure proper shift handover procedures are followed.
- Actively participate in Kaizen events, 5S initiatives, TPM activities, Loss Analysis, and special projects.
- Complete and document activities that measure quality and productivity accurately and timely.
- Follow and adhere to safety, quality, and production-related Work Instructions, Memos, and SOPs.
- Assist with line changeovers, including the collection of wash water.
Qualifications and Requirements
- High School diploma or equivalent.
- Three years of previous experience in a chemical plant or warehouse environment.
- Two years of previous experience with reaction chemistry.
- Basic English language proficiency for reading and writing.
- Experience with Microsoft Outlook.
- Ability to use basic math, including add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division of whole numbers, fractions, percentages, and decimals.
- Forklift driving certification or ability.
- Ability to meet the physical requirements of the position, including lifting/carrying up to 50 pounds.
- Must be able to pass a drug screen and physical exam.
- No immigration sponsorship is available for this role.
